Abstract
We address the practical problem of fixed-outline VLSI floorplanning with minimizing the objective of area. This problem was shown significantly much more difficult than the well-researched floorplan problems without fixed-outline regime (N. Saurabh, et al. (2001)). We successfully develop an algorithm with evolutionary search to efficiently handle the fixed-die floorplanning problem and achieve near 100% successful probability, on the average.
